Thyroid and parathyroid conditions affect a substantial portion of the population, ranging from benign to malignant lesions, with some cases necessitating surgical intervention for management. These conditions can manifest in various forms, including thyroid nodules, hyperthyroidism, hypothyroidism and parathyroid adenomas. While medical management may suffice for certain cases, surgical removal becomes imperative for others, particularly when malignancy is suspected or when the condition causes significant impairment. Despite advancements in surgical techniques, thyroid and parathyroid surgeries still pose risks, albeit relatively low, with serious complications occurring in less than 2% of cases. However, the likelihood of complications increases when procedures are performed by less experienced surgeons or in complex cases involving tumor proximity to vital structures such as the recurrent laryngeal nerve or the parathyroid glands. As such, patients are strongly advised to thoroughly evaluate their surgeon’s credentials, ensuring specialized training and a high volume of thyroid and parathyroid surgeries performed annually.

Thyroid and parathyroid surgeries, like any surgical procedure, carry inherent risks, ranging from minor complications to severe injuries. While some adverse outcomes are unavoidable due to the complexity of the surgery or the patient’s underlying health condition, others stem from surgical errors or negligence on the part of the medical team. These errors may involve a failure to adhere to the standard of care expected from surgeons in similar circumstances, resulting in preventable harm to the patient. Regrettably, such medical negligence can lead to devastating consequences, sometimes necessitating permanent interventions like tracheostomy, a procedure to create a direct airway through an incision in the trachea in the most severe cases.
